Ingredients
Scale
- 6 sheets phyllo dough
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ter (melted)
- 1 cup high-quality honey
- 1/2 cup granulated sugar
- 1 tsp ground cinnamon
- 1/2 cup chopped nuts (almonds or walnuts)
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
- Unroll phyllo dough on a clean surface and cover with a damp cloth.
- Brush one sheet of phyllo with melted butter; layer another on top. Repeat for six layers.
- In a bowl, mix honey, sugar, cinnamon, and nuts. Spread over phyllo layers.
- Fold edges over filling to form a rectangle/square and brush the top with more butter.
- Bake on a baking sheet for 30-35 minutes until golden brown. Drizzle with additional honey before serving.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 35 minutes
